Wave of Resignations Within the Board of the Sept-Îles Figure Skating Club - Le Nord-Côtier

Summary by Le Nord-Côtier
Five of the nine members of the board of directors of the Sept-Îles Figure Skating Club recently resigned, causing a shock wave within the organization. It was at the end of the last Board meeting, held on September 7, that President Yan Leblanc decided to leave.
